The UN as in international body has failed to resolve conflicts globally.?

The UN as in international body has failed to resolve conflicts globally. It is a weak and ineffective instrument in promoting peace and security in the global community.

I need to create a thesis for this statement (if i agree or not) and two arguments? Any opinions?

    You could argue that it hasn't and provide conflicts such as Vietnam, the Falklands, Iraq-Iran, Iraq, Rwandan genocide, Pol Pot, Sri Lanka, Yugoslavia etc. This would easily support the argument that it has been ineffectual.

    However, to a large degree these are civil ethnic wars. There has been little inter-state warfare on the scale of wwii since the UN's inception. By and large the major powers have not been involved in open conflict; hence the phrase Pax Americana and The Long Peace. Both phrases refer to period of peace between major powers. You should look at the UNs role in this peace. Importantly, to get a top grade, you should look at what causes conflict and threatens security; migration, poverty, changing social and poltical environments, economic stagnation, have major influence in causing war and threatening security. how has the UN mitigated these threats? You can look at the peace keeping exercises in the Balkans and Iraq for support.
